* Remove signature helper completely from Invidious
The official way to reproduce video with Invidious now is by using
Invidious Companion which uses Youtube.JS with a Javascript Interpreter
that can successfully decrypt youtube video URLs.
Sig helper has not been used for a long time, is beyond broken and no
one has plans to fix it and maintain it.

Video information from youtube always weight about ~60KB uncompressed.
When using Deflate to compress that information, it gets compressed down
to ~15KB, so now you will be able to store up to 4x entries more with
caching enabled.
For context, nadeko.net Invidious instance stores 54.7k keys, since we
also store the `time` in a different key associated to the video ID, the
real count of videos cached would be 27.3k. With compression enabled,
the Redis database will be able to store up to 4 times more videos in
cache, which is 109.2k videos cached.

This commit adds a new configuration option `max_request_line_size` that allows
users to increase the HTTP request line size limit. This is particularly useful
for handling very long continuation tokens that can cause 414 (URI Too Long) errors.
Changes:
- Add `max_request_line_size` property to Config class
- Configure Kemal server to use the custom limit if specified
- Document the option in config.example.yml with recommendations
- Add examples in docker-compose.yml for both YAML and env var configuration
The default behavior remains unchanged (8KB limit) unless explicitly configured.
This provides a solution for users experiencing 414 errors without affecting
existing installations.

This PR adds a configuration option to control the preloading of video data on
page load with the HTML5 'preload'[1] attribute on the `<video>` element.
The option is enabled by default, meaning that the `preload` attribute's value
will be 'auto'. If users want to prevent preloading of video data, they
can disable the option, which will set the attribute value to 'none'.

This PR adds two new config option, to pass a PO token (config 'po_token') and
a visitor ID (config 'visitor_data') to Youtube. These two strings are required
to play videos using the WEB client.
Warning: These strings gives much more identifiable information to Google!
If the po_token setting is filled in, then the WEB client is used. If not, the
Android client is used. TvHtml5ScreenEmbed will still be used as a fallback.
